On Tuesday, the short-range ballistic missile Prithvi-II was successfully launched from the Integrated Test Range, Chandipur, off the coast of Odisha.
The Prithvi-II missile, a well-established system, has been an important element of India’s nuclear deterrence. The missile hit its target with pinpoint accuracy. According to a Defense Ministry announcement, the user training launch successfully confirmed all operational and technical aspects of the missile.
As part of a user training trial, the indigenously produced nuclear-capable missile was also successfully test-fired at night.
The missile is a tried-and-true device that can hit targets with pinpoint accuracy. It has a striking range of around 350 kilometres.
The Prithvi II missile, which was inducted into India’s Strategic Forces Command in 2003, was developed by DRDO under India’s famous Integrated Guided Missile Development Programme.
